Pac-Man (パックマン Pakkuman?) is a video game character created by Toru Iwatani a programmer of Namco. He is Namco's mascot and is one of the most famous video game characters of all time. He appears in the Pac-Man series of games which range from maze games to platformers. His wife is Ms. Pac-Man.
